Latest Patents
Huang's most recent patents include the "Method for Cleaning Reclaimed Water Reuse Device" and the "Reclaimed Water Reuse Device." The cleaning method involves detecting the operational signals from a clean water supply device and activating either a first aeration device or a backwash device to perform membrane module maintenance. This process is designed to restore the reclaimed water reuse device to its normal operating state effectively.
The reclaimed water reuse device itself comprises a biological reaction tank, a membrane module, various drainage and outlet devices, and a backwash device. The innovative design ensures optimal water treatment by facilitating efficient membrane cleaning and maintaining water quality during the reuse process.
